The video tutorial, led by Ross from the Royal Society of Chemistry, introduces chromatography as a simple experiment that can be done at home. It details two methods using household items like kitchen roll, water, and colored pens. The first method involves drawing on kitchen roll and adding water drops to observe color separation. The second method uses a strip of kitchen roll placed in water to see ink separation. Both methods reveal the composition of colors in the ink. The video encourages viewers to try the experiment themselves and share their results.
